Since its release on March 31, JUMBO has successfully garnered 2 million viewers in just 10 days and has made a significant impact on its audience. Behind this successful film are indeed great people who worked hard to create JUMBO, which took 5 years and involved more than 200 animators.

One of the hardworking individuals behind the scenes is Ryan Adriandhy, who serves as the director of this film. Known as one of the founders of the Stand Up Comedy community, Ryan was the champion of the first season of the Stand Up Comedy Indonesia (SUCI) competition. Having loved animation since childhood, Ryan eventually decided to pursue a Master's degree in Film and Animation at the Rochester Institute of Technology in the United States. Ryan Adriandhy, whose full name is Ryan Adriandhy Halim, is an artist born in Jakarta known as a comedian, animator, director, as well as an actor and presenter. Since becoming active in the entertainment world in 2011, he has continued to showcase his abilities in various creative fields and is now actively sharing his work through social media

<nil>

Since childhood, Ryan has shown a great interest in the world of animation and comics, although he was once a victim of bullying, this did not extinguish his passion for creating. His career shone brighter after winning the first season of Stand Up Comedy Indonesia (SUCI) and continuing his animation studies through a Fulbright scholarship at the Rochester Institute of Technology in the United States, which further deepened his expertise in the field of animation.

<nil>

His directorial debut began with an animated film titled JUMBO which was released on March 31, 2025, telling the story of a boy named Don who wants to prove his abilities in a talent competition despite often being underestimated. Produced by Visinema Animation involving around 200 local animators, this film not only captivated local audiences but also opened up great opportunities for Indonesian animation to be recognized on the international stage.

<nil>

JUMBO has been a huge success in the market, breaking records as the highest-grossing Indonesian animated film of all time, attracting over one million viewers within just one week of screening. The film is even planned to be shown in 17 other countries, demonstrating the strong potential of Indonesian animation which is now starting to be recognized globally thanks to the work of Ryan Adriandhy.
